Space exploration was the newest part of the frontier Kennedy was referring to,
but he also saw the US on the verge of solving some of the old problems of war, social injustice and poverty.

The Kennedy quote is :
"[W]e stand today on the edge of a New Frontier -- the frontier of 1960s, the frontier of unknown opportunities and perils, the frontier of unfilled hopes and unfilled dreams. ... Beyond that frontier are uncharted areas of science and space, unsolved problems of peace and war, unconquered problems of ignorance and prejudice, unanswered questions of poverty and surplus.

New Frontier was the term he used for his program. Camelot was also used to describe the Kennedy presidency.
New Frontier was the name attached to Kennedy's domestic package. The name came from a phrase in Kennedy 1960 nomination acceptance speech in which he said that America was standing on the verge of a new frontier.
